Why read it?

1 author picked From Front Porch to Back Seat as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

While we can hardly think about couples today without the idea of dating, the practice was new and very edgy in the early 20th century.

Beth Bailey shows how the classic “dating and rating” complex emerged and became not just accepted but expected among middle-class couples. She also takes us through the transition to the “going steady” complex later in the century.
